Dzeko to Galatasaray?

One time Tottenham target and for mer Manchester City and Wolfsburg striker Edin Dzeko looks to be on the move again after only a year in Italy that didn't go especially well.

After a disappointing spell in Serie A, Roma could offload Edin Dzeko and he could be heading to Turkish giants Galatasaray.

A meeting between Lupi coach Luciano Spalletti and sporting director Walter Sabatini will take place on Tuesday, and they will discuss the future of the former Manchester City striker to see if he remains in the tactician's plans or if he should depart.

Irfan Redzepagic, who is Dzeko's agent, had a meeting on Saturday with Galatasaray sporting director Cenk Ergun about the possibility of bringing the Bosnian international to Turkey, but the Super Lig side might have problems meeting the €13-15 million price tag that Roma have put in place.

Two issues for the Turkish club is that they will not be playing in Europe in 2016/17, so Dzeko might not agree to such a move, and he also has a yearly salary of €4.5m. However, Gala believe he can make an impact in the Super Lig like German striker Mario Gomez has at Besiktas.

If a deal with Galatasaray cannot be completed, the 30-year-old could return to the Premier League and transfer to Liverpool.
